Output 30e389a4661e0e7d8130830fa4abb3d4a25bba696b4b664f013506c2c4ef854b:3

value
13111844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dff235d320f569d7050b3ef88de55c4a6ec2d114 OP_EQUAL
address
MUKH5GiVPkMEmDGeQrM5i8h1PLsDnHnyvq
transaction
30e389a4661e0e7d8130830fa4abb3d4a25bba696b4b664f013506c2c4ef854b
spent
true